Although sending applications to different employers increases chances of finding employment, applying for any job is not encouraged. Many people waste precious time and energy applying for jobs that do not fit personal needs and expectations. Start by defining your qualifications and areas of interests. Look at online job listings to identify opportunities that fit your needs. If you are unable to identify the right opportunities, consult a career expert to help you explore the market and set priorities.<br />

Since job application is completed online, resumes, cover letters and application forms must fit the set criteria. The first step is to read and understand job descriptions. Create a resume and cover letter using keywords in the job description, but avoid the use of verbatim. Make sure your resume highlights the skills and qualifications the employer is looking for.<br />
<br />
Sending mass emails to recruiting agents or employers is a common mistake most job seekers commit. Job applicants are expected to contact recruiting firms once they have submitted resumes. The best time to follow up is one week past application deadline. You can also follow up after a week if the employer or employment agency has not given a specific deadline date.<br />
